Package: arduino
Version: 0018+dfsg-3
Severity: important
When I try to upload a program using the arduino workbench to an Arduino
Decimilia
AtMega8 if complains:-
avrdude: Device Signature = 0x00000000
avrdude: Yikes! Invalid device signature
Double check connection and try again, or use -F to override
The workbench does not provide a means to specify -F.
I found a reference through google that the version of avrdude shipped with
the arduino package is patched specially to fix this problem (which I think
is something to do with the arduino bootloaded).
Please add this patch (I have no idea where is is to be found) to the Debian
version of avrdude.

Changes:
arduino (0018+dfsg-4) unstable; urgency=low
.
* Corrected and added stanzas to debian/copyright for
- libraries/Ethernet/utility/w5100.* (GPL-2)
- examples/ArduinoISP/ArduinoISP.pde (BSD)
Thanks to Eberhard Fahle.
* Depends on openjdk-6-jdk OR sun-java6-jdk. Thanks to Guillermo Reisch
* Added support for Debian's avrdude upload protocol in
hardware/arduino/boards.txt, thanks to Ami Chayun (Closes: 588083)
* Debian policy 3.9.0 (no changes)
